I’m actually wondering what is censorship. Because if you are going to include every nonsense blog and asshat that has some unfounded garbage to spew, the quality of your product will potentially be garbage. So you end up with the question on what sources to include, and you probably end up with authorative sources that are regarded higher.

The issue we already see with Google search is that seo spam and generated websites that all form a large circle jerk are setup to fool the algorithm. This will be the case for llms as well. The longer they are in use the better people will understand how to game the system. And then bad actors will get these things to say whatever they want.

I don’t know a solution, but my guess is that it lies in what used to happen for the encyclopedia Britannica etc… large pools of experts that curate the underlaying sources. Like in libraries etc.
